Location is an essential aspect to consider
Tulum is essentially divided into two zones - the beach-zone and the city center (pueblo). Both zones offer their own unique advantages and it is crucial to determine which is best suited for your needs. The beach-zone boasts an array of luxury boutique hotels and resorts, as well as exquisite beach clubs, but be aware that the beach road can be heavily trafficked. On the other hand, the city center presents a wealth of dining, shopping, and entertainment options, and a more relaxed atmosphere - especially at night. Both zones are roughly 15 minutes by car apart, however, the exact duration may vary depending on traffic.

Amenities are another aspect to consider when choosing your accommodation. Despite being nestled in the midst of a jungle and natural beachfront, Tulum provides every amenity that one could desire. However, it is worth noting that most hotels in the beach-zone rely on diesel generators for electricity and fresh water is delivered by truck on a daily basis. To be as eco-friendly as possible, it is recommended to be mindful of your water and electricity usage.

Budget is an important consideration, and one must keep in mind that the most prestigious luxury and boutique hotels are located in the beach-zone of Tulum. Additionally, while beautiful hotels are also found in the pueblo, there are more budget-friendly options located in the city center. When choosing your accommodation, it is imperative to balance your budget with your desired location and amenities to ensure a fulfilling and memorable stay in Tulum, Mexico.

When to travel to Tulum?

When contemplating a trip to Tulum, timing is an important aspect to consider. The high season in Tulum falls between the months of November and January, where the weather is perfect and the crowds are at their peak. This is the prime time to visit Tulum, if you are looking to soak up the sun on its pristine beaches and enjoy the bustling atmosphere of the city.

However, if you prefer a less crowded and more tranquil environment, you may want to consider visiting before or after the high season. This not only means fewer crowds but also lower rates for accommodations, including hotels and apartments. It's a great time to take advantage of more personalized experiences and indulge in Tulum's laidback lifestyle.

While Tulum's weather is generally warm and sunny, the summer months of July to September can get a bit hot and humid, with a higher chance of rain. It's best to be prepared for this and plan accordingly if you choose to visit during these months.

From our experience, one of the best times to visit Tulum is from February to April. This time frame offers ideal weather conditions, with warm and sunny days, and a comfortable and refreshing sea breeze. Additionally, this is a time when there is still a good turnout of visitors, allowing for a vibrant and lively atmosphere while still maintaining a sense of serenity.

Types of Accommodations

Rooftop pool with sunbeds

A. Hotels

Hotels range from luxurious, opulent retreats to budget-friendly options that won't break the bank. Whether you're seeking a lavish getaway or a more modest experience, the city has something for everyone.

   Luxury Hotels

For those who want to indulge in a life of luxury, Tulum offers a wealth of high-end hotels that cater to the most discerning travelers. These properties boast state-of-the-art amenities, top-notch service, and breathtaking ocean or jungle views. From infinity pools to spas, these hotels provide the ultimate escape for those seeking to be pampered.

   Boutique Hotels

For a more intimate and personalized experience, the boutique hotels are the way to go. With fewer rooms and a focus on personalized service, these hotels offer a more exclusive experience. From charming decor to unique amenities, each boutique hotel in Tulum has its own unique personality.

   Budget Hotels

For travelers on a tight budget, Tulum also offers a range of budget-friendly hotels that provide basic amenities and comfortable rooms at an affordable price. These hotels are perfect for those who want to explore without breaking the bank.
